Transaction e743139df5c5d30c206455b1b8fbdf176e4d593935a83a98cf30b915ef9bde10
1 Input
1 Output
-
e743139df5c5d30c206455b1b8fbdf176e4d593935a83a98cf30b915ef9bde10:0
- value
- 103368628
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cabd27f4ca9cf0416d71d3fd5868faf121a1746 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FHQFM1xgKKSHMcjfddVSuJrFhygJNwjjx